    Abstract: A conductive roll for electrophotographic device is provided. The conductive roll for electrophotographic device 10 includes a shaft body 12 and a non-foamed elastic body layer 14 formed on an outer periphery of the shaft body 12. The elastic body layer 14 is made of a cross-linked product of a silicone rubber composition containing the following (a) to (d), and a secondary particle diameter of the following (d) in the elastic body layer 14 is within a range of 100 to 500 nm. (a) is an organopolysiloxane, (b) is a crosslinking agent, (c) is a microcapsule catalyst made of fine resin particles which encapsulate a crosslinking catalyst by a resin other than a silicone resin, and (d) is silica with a BET specific surface area of 70 to 350 m2/g.

    Abstract: Provided is a development roll for electrophotography devices in which image defects are suppressed and which achieve both maintenance of high charging properties and discharging properties. The development roll is provided with a shaft member, an elastic substance layer formed on the outer circumference of the shaft member, an intermediate layer formed on the outer circumference of the elastic substance layer, and a surface layer formed on the outer circumference of the intermediate layer. The volume resistivity of the surface layer 18 is within the range of 1.0×1014 to 1.0×1020 ?·cm, and the volume resistivity of the intermediate layer 16 is within the range of 1.0×107 to 1.0×1013 ?·cm.

    Abstract: Provided is a developing roll (R) with which it is possible to suppress toner stress in a low-temperature and low-humidity environment. A developing roll (R) for an electrophotographic device has a surface layer (1). In a surface hardness histogram (10) of the surface layer (1) measured by using an atomic force microscope (AFM), the surface hardness (H) at the top peak (P) is in the range of 10-55 MPa, and the area ratio (S) of the histogram portion corresponding to a surface hardness of 45 MPa or below in relation to the entire histogram is 65% or above.
